I'm known for my work on the first compilers, which allowed us to write programs in English-like statements rather than just machine code. This made programming much more accessible and efficient. I also contributed to the development of early computers like the Harvard Mark I and was a strong advocate for standardization in programming languages. My goal was always to make computers more useful and understandable.
